The only Henschels produced between 1925 and 1942 with a C in the middle were -apart from the 6 C 1 (6 C 2 and 6 C3)- the 4 C 1 (4 C 2) and the 5 C 1 (5 C 2 and 5 C 3).  Let's say the 4 C 2 ?

A bit more info has come to light now regarding my efforts to upgrade to Windows 10.
It wasn't the Firewall per se that caused the problem, it was SonicWALL VPN Client Manager, which is the method by which my laptop connects to my PC on the Network at my office.

It's sorted in that the problems created by Windows 10 are over (as I'm back on to Windows 8.1), but now I can't connect to my office via SonicWALL... Curing one problem always creates another...!
